Daily News | Eagles executive Catherine Raiche expected to join the Cleveland Browns and Andrew Berry

Eagles vice president of football operations Catherine Raiche is expected to join the Cleveland Browns for a high-ranking position within the front office, league sources confirmed to The Inquirer on Tuesday evening.

Raiche, 33, was known to hold the highest-ranking team personnel position among any woman in NFL history. She joins former Eagles vice president and current Browns general manager Andrew Berry, who is entering his third season with Cleveland. Earlier in the offseason, Raiche interviewed for the then-vacant Vikings general manager position.

Before joining the Eagles as a football operations/player personnel coordinator in 2019, Raiche held various executive roles with the Tampa Bay Vipers, Toronto Argonauts, and Montreal Alouettes. Raiche is the third member of the front office to leave the Eagles this offseason following the departures of Ian Cunningham and Brandon Brown .
